Lake Braddock extended their winning streak to three games thanks to a huge performance from Payton Holmes. Lake Braddock came within six points of losing the streak, but they secured a 28-22 W against Forest Park thanks in part to Holmes, who rushed for 121 yards and two TDs on only 14 carries. His longest rush was for an impressive 60 yards, which helps to explain his lofty yards per carry total.

On the defensive side of the ball, a lot of the credit has to go to Lake Braddock's defense and their seven sacks. The heavy lifting was done by Jerard Pulliam and Christian Palma, who racked up four sacks between them. Palma is on a roll when it comes to sacks, as he's now posted at least one in each of the last three games he's played dating back to last season. Lake Braddock got some further help from Jack Podsednik: he picked up a sack and made 13 total tackles (4.0 for loss).

Lake Braddock's win bumped their record up to 3-0. As for Forest Park, this is the second loss in a row for them and nudges their season record down to 1-2.

Lake Braddock will get to enjoy the win for a while: their next game is against Robinson at 7:00 p.m. on the 26th. As for Forest Park, they will challenge Gainesville at 7:00 p.m. on Friday.
